Ingredients
US|METRIC
15 SERVINGS
- 1 Tbsp. flaxseed meal (+ 3 tablespoons water)
- 1/2 cup peanut butter (creamy natural drippy, only peanuts + salt as ingredients)
- 1/2 tsp. vanilla extract (optional)
- 1/4 cup pure maple syrup
- 1/3 cup blanched almond flour (packed fine, pack it like you would with brown sugar)
- 1/2 tsp. baking soda

My mom has a number of food allergies, so we made these for her to give her a little something sweet to savor during the holidays. She can’t have peanuts, so we subbed almond butter and used coconut flour instead of almond flour to avoid an overly nutty taste. We also added 1 tbsp Dutch-processed 100% cocoa and 1 tbsp brown sugar. Really good, but not quite as sweet as we might have liked. We’ll make some adjustments and definitely make again.
